- W2561520682 abstract "Some new metal(II) complexes of asymmetric Schiff base ligand were prepared by template technique. The shaped complexes are in binuclear structures and were explained through elemental analysis, molar conductivity, various spectroscopic methods (IR, U.V–Vis, XRD, ESR), thermal (TG) and magnetic moment measurements. The IR spectra were done demonstrating that the Schiff base ligand acts as neutral tetradentate moiety in all metal complexes. The electronic absorption spectra represented octahedral geometry for all complexes, while, the ESR spectra for Cu(II) complex showed axially symmetric g-tensor parameter with g׀׀ > g⊥ > 2.0023 indicating to 2B1g ground state with (dx2−y2)1 configuration. The nature of the solid residue created from TG estimations was affirmed utilizing IR and XRD spectra. The biological activity of the prepared complexes was studied against Land Snails. Additionally, the in vitro antitumor activity of the synthesized complexes with Hepatocellular Carcinoma cell (Hep-G2) was examined. It was observed that Zn(II) complex (5), exhibits a high inhibition of growth of the cell line with IC50 of 7.09 μg/mL." @default.
